对于变化频率非常快的数据,如果还是选择传统的静态缓存方式(Memocached等。)要显示数据,访问缓存可能要花费很多,不能很好的满足需求。然而,基于存储器的NoSQL 数据库 like Redis非常适合作为实时数据的容器。然而,通常需要数据的可靠性。使用MySQL作为数据存储,不会因为内存问题造成数据丢失,同时利用关系数据库的特性可以实现很多功能。
但目前还没有针对这种需求的特别成熟的解决方案或工具,所以采用Gearman PHP MySQLUDF的组合来实现从MySQL到Redis的数据异步复制。从MySQL到Redis的数据复制方案,无论是MySQL还是Redis,都有自己的机制data 同步。常用的MySQL的主/从模式,是通过分析主在从端的binlog实现的。这样的数据复制实际上是一个异步过程,但是当服务器都在同一个内网时,异步延迟几乎可以忽略。
5、2019数据架构选型必读:1月 数据库产品技术解析当前目录DBEngines 数据库排行榜新闻公告一、RDBMS家族二、NoSQL家族三、NewSQL家族四、时间序列五、大数据生态圈六、国内数据库概述七、Cloud 数据库 8、发射需要阅读全文的同学可以点击文末【阅读原文】或登录下载。
DBEngines排名的数据基于五个不同的因素:新闻快讯1。2018年9月24日,微软公布了SQLServer2019的预览版,SQLServer2019将结合Spark打造统一的数据平台。2.2018年10月5日,ElasticSearch在纽约证券交易所上市。3.亚马逊弃用甲骨文数据库软件,导致黄金时段最大的一次仓库宕机。
6、用java实现h2 数据库和mysql 数据库实时数据 同步1,h2 数据库你写一个dao类(比如insert method),mysql也写一个mydao类(比如insertmysql())。插入h2 数据库时,newdao()。inser(sql)。newmydao()。insert MySQL(SQL);2.也可以直接去数据库操作写存储过程和游标自动化同步。3.使用第三方插件。
7、pg 数据库集群怎么保证数据 同步在PG 数据库 cluster中,通常使用streamingreplication机制来保证数据同步。具体实现过程如下:1 .安装并启动主库和从库的PostgreSQL 数据库服务,然后在主库上配置流复制。2.在主库中创建备份(基本备份),并将其发送到所有从库。每个从库使用相同的基本备份。从库还将不断地从主库接收WAL日志,以将同步保存在主库中。
然后,事务的改变将被发送到所有从库。4.从库中收到更改后,它们将被应用来更新自己的数据库,当所有的改变被应用到从库时,从库的状态将与主库一致。从库会定期向主库发送心跳信息,保证连接丢失时能及时重新连接,5.如果主库出现故障,从库可以自动切换到新的主库。此时也可以自动切换流复制,因此不需要手动干预,应该注意,在流复制期间,主库和从库之间的网络延迟可能会导致从库的更新稍微滞后。
文章TAG:数据库 同步 插件 canal 数据库同步插件